Output f6ffde75aa0ac202d9565f212aa2600a93f85c3566ea65d0549ea164dafa0e1e:1

value
16345200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b89ed0f63adb41da20032975aa2ae0bffcaa2e OP_EQUAL
address
3D4UsykjZEWeyYfpFDduyMM8MwGyTQTsW6
transaction
f6ffde75aa0ac202d9565f212aa2600a93f85c3566ea65d0549ea164dafa0e1e
confirmations
270307
spent
true